THE DIVISION OF PALEOGEOGRAPHIC AREAS OF PERMIAN FUSULINIDS IN WESTERN HUBEI AND NORTHWESTERN HUNAN AND THEIR SIGNIFICANCE
      Permian fusulinid faunas in western Hubei and northwestern Hunan not only show distinct zoning in vertical section (see Table 1), but laterally there are also appreciable changes in fusulinid assemblages.It is particularly the case with the fusulinid fauna represented by the Neoschwagerina and Yabeina zones in the upper part of the Maokou Formation, which is regionally confined to a definite areal extent, designated by the author the Neoschwagerina-Yabeina ecotope (ecological group) (called the N-Y ecotope for short). The N-Y ecotope covers a northwest-trending narrow region approximately 10-15 km wide and 200 km in length from Maogang, Dayong, Hunan, to Shizhu, Sichuan. In this paper, the author expounds with concrete materials the ecological environment of the N-Y ecotope and the paleogeo-graphic features of this environment, and concludes that the N-Y ecotope was actually the main part of the coal-accumulating depression that had existed prior to the coal-accumulating stage between the Upper and Lower Permian in western Hubei and northwestern Hunan. Hence the N-Y ecotope and its surrounding areas should be considered to be the main direction of coalfield prediction and exploration in the region. After the coal-accumulating stage, the lateral distribution of the Late Permian fusulinid zones of Codonofusiella, Gallowayinella and Palaeofusulina sinensis (in ascending order) also had a definite areal extent, designated in this paper the Codonofusiella-Gallowayinella-Palaeofusulina sinensis ecotope (ecological group) (called the C-G-P ecotope for short) . The areal extent of the C-G-P ecotope inherited that of the N-Y ecotope under certain conditions, and both show roughly the same ecological environment and conditions; therefore the study of the areal extent of the C-G-P ecotope will also contribute to the study of the regularity governing the distribution of the coal-accumulating depression prior to its existence.
